About processor

The Intel Xeon Max 9470 is an incredibly powerful processor that is designed for server applications. With a total of 52 cores and 104 threads, this processor is capable of handling massive workloads and multitasking with ease. The base frequency of 2 GHz can be turbo boosted up to 3.5 GHz, providing exceptional performance for demanding tasks. The 10 nm technology used in this processor ensures efficient power usage and thermal management, despite the high performance capabilities. Additionally, the large 105MB L3 cache allows for quick access to frequently used data, further enhancing the overall performance. With a TDP of 350W, it's important to ensure proper cooling and power supply for this processor, as it can generate significant heat under heavy workloads.
